Closing Date: January 13, 2023

Reporting to the Lead, Maintenance Training, the Training Coordinator is responsible for the development, implementation, and delivery of training at Line Creek Operations.

To be successful, we are looking for someone with excellent interpersonal, communication and team management skills, who has a passion for contributing to other people’s personal and professional growth. We require someone with the ability to schedule training and keep accurate records of all training events. Lastly, this role requires someone with strong attention to detail and the ability to adapt and prioritize contending demands in a fast-paced environment.

Responsibilities:
  • Be a courageous safety leader, adhere to and sponsor safety and environmental rules and procedures
  • Provide and source training which includes job based, and developmental instruction using materials that have been created internally and externally
  • Deliver comprehensive training based on safe work practices and training requirements
  • Provide direction to management and collaborate with multiple departments to determine, prepare, and develop training needs and priorities, assess training programs, and develop training courses, plans, and solutions
  • Deliver lectures, presentations, and new hire orientations
  • Conduct operator focused training on Forklift, Aerial and Scissor lifts, and Overhead Cranes
  • Conduct Safety training on confined space, fall arrest, rigging, and hazardous energy isolation


Qualifications:
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in an industrial environment in either training or a safety focused role with a broad scope of experience
  • Strong experience in Project Management and Change Management
  • Excellent digital literacy and proficient with Microsoft Office Suite®; Word, Excel, Outlook, and PowerPoint

Teck is a diversified resource company committed to responsible mining and mineral development with major business units focused on copper, steelmaking coal and zinc, as well as investments in energy assets.

Headquartered in Vancouver, Canada, its shares are list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ange under the symbols TECK.A and TECK.B and the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ol TECK.
